Job Title : Backend Developer (Rust)
About Us
We are building scalable, high-performance applications that power next-generation digital experiences. Our team values clean code, strong architecture, and a culture of collaboration. If you're passionate about backend systems and love working with Rust, we'd love to hear from you!
Role Overview
As a Backend Developer, you will design, build, and maintain backend services with a focus on performance, reliability, and scalability. You will collaborate with frontend developers, DevOps engineers, and product managers to deliver secure and efficient APIs, microservices, and data pipelines.
Key Responsibilities
Develop, test, and maintain backend services using Rust.
Design RESTful / GraphQL APIs and integrate with databases.
Optimize performance and ensure reliability of backend systems.
Implement security and data protection best practices.
Write clean, maintainable, and well-documented code.
Collaborate with cross-functional teams on system design and architecture.
Debug, troubleshoot, and improve existing backend services.
Requirements
Strong proficiency in Rust programming language.
Experience with backend frameworks (e.g., Actix, Rocket, Axum).
Knowledge of databases (PostgreSQL, MySQL, or NoSQL solutions).
Understanding of microservices, distributed systems, and API design.
Familiarity with version control (Git) and CI / CD pipelines.
Solid understanding of memory management, concurrency, and performance tuning.
Experience with cloud platforms (AWS, GCP, or Azure) is a plus.
Bachelor's degree in Computer Science, Engineering, or related field (preferred).
Nice-to-Have Skills
Experience with containerization (Docker, Kubernetes).
Familiarity with message queues (Kafka, RabbitMQ, NATS).
Knowledge of WebAssembly or blockchain-related Rust projects.
What We Offer
Competitive salary and performance bonuses.
Flexible work environment (remote / hybrid options).
Opportunity to work on cutting-edge projects with Rust.
Professional growth and learning opportunities.
Internship Details
Duration : 6 months
Stipend : ₹2,000 per month
Location : Remote / Hybrid (depending on company needs)
Show more
Show less
Skills Required
actix, Rust, Postgresql, Performance Tuning, Concurrency, Kafka, API Design, Memory Management, Nosql, Rabbitmq, Git, Gcp, Docker, Mysql, Azure, Kubernetes, Aws
Flutter Developer • India